Jan 9, 2019 - kay rasmus nielsen (march 12, 1886 – june 21, 1957) was a danish illustrator who was popular in the early 20th century, the golden age of illustration. He joined the ranks of arthur rackham and edmund dulac in enjoying the success of the gift books of the early 20th century. Nielsen is also known for his collaborations with disney for whom he contributed many story sketches.

Since the original publication of the tales of peter rabbit in 1902, over 100 million copies of her stories have been sold. Beatrix had acquired fourteen farms and over 4,000 acres of farmland in the lake district during the later years of her life which she bequeathed to the national trust, a conservation organization in the united kingdom.
